Who is Mytanfeet Costa Rica Travel?
Hello!
We are Yeison and Samantha, the couple behind Mytanfeet Costa Rica Travel. We are a married couple living in Costa Rica full time.
Yeison (pronounced like Jason) is Costa Rican, born and raised.
Samantha moved to Costa Rica in 2012 from the United States.
We have been traveling together in Costa Rica since 2010 and love sharing our stories, tips and experiences on Mytanfeet Costa Rica Travel.
It’s a lot of fun and we’re very lucky to have been doing this for many years!

Why we started Mytanfeet Costa Rica Travel Blog
When Samantha first moved to Costa Rica, she started this Costa Rica travel blog as a way to document her new life abroad but it grew into much more than just a journal.
Back in 2012, there weren’t many travel blogs about Costa Rica. There weren’t even Instagrammers. So the more we wrote blog posts, made videos and posted photos the more our blog grew.
We love Costa Rica and our goal is to help everyone fall in love with it, especially Yeison. He wants everyone to have a wonderful time in his country and discover pura vida!
Furthermore, we wanted to share our stories and tips from not just a foreigner, but also a local point of view. Together, we have traveled throughout the entire country and we are always re-visiting places to update our content with the latest information, as much as possible.
We think sets us a bit apart from other blogs and websites, especially nowadays when you find content from influencers who have only visited Costa Rica once for short periods of times.
Yeison has worked in the tourism industry for over 20 years and has traveled extensively in Costa Rica. He loves sharing his insider local knowledge so people can experience his country a little bit like a local.

We just came back home from our wonderful Costa Rica trip. Thanks to the useful information (and video blogs) from this site, we could drive and enjoy touring a major part of the country (SJO-La Fortuna-Tamarindo-Monte Verde-Manuel Antonio-San Jose-SJO) without any problem. We won’t know whether one would get any better deal from another rental company, but we were very happy with the brand new Hyundai 5 seater 4×4 SUV that we rented from Adobe (@319 per week including mandatory liability insurance) through this site. Pay special attention to the notes on the road conditions. Part of the road was rough (particularly the road to and from Monte Verde) and windy. You do need a 4×4. (I must say that the road from Arenal to Tamarindo is getting better. )
